Can I use a 800 mhz DVI logic board

History

I have a PowerBook G4 667 mhz DVI 15 inch with a bad logic board. Can I replace it with a 800 mhz DVI 15 inch logic board? are they interchangeable? Also, what about switching display assemblies from one to the other?

Yes, you can put a 800 MHz DVI board in a 667 MHz machine, but it is recommended to also install a secondary fan as well (the 667 MHz machines do not have the secondary fan). As for the displays, DVI displays are also interchangeable. You cannot, however use earlier Titanium model displays (Mercury or Onyx machines).
